Job Summary

MECA is seeking a compassionate and skilled Social Worker to join our Early Intervention team supporting children from birth to age 3 with diagnosed developmental conditions. This role provides meaningful, relationship-based services delivered directly in home and community settings, helping families build skills, access resources, and support healthy child development during critical early years.

This is a highly impactful position ideal for clinicians who are passionate about pediatric social work, early intervention, family counseling, and community-based practice.

What You Will Do

As an Early Intervention Social Worker, you will:

  • Provide social-emotional developmental evaluations for infants and toddlers within the family context
  • Deliver individualized counseling and family support services in home and community settings
  • Conduct home visits to assess parent-child interaction and environmental needs
  • Develop evidence-based recommendations and intervention strategies
  • Coordinate community, medical, and supportive resources for families
  • Participate in IFSP meetings, transition planning, and interdisciplinary team collaboration
  • Complete timely, accurate evaluation reports and daily documentation
  • Support families in achieving developmental and functional goals
  • Collaborate with therapists and early intervention professionals across disciplines

Work Environment

This is a field-based position providing services in homes and community settings. Flexibility, independence, and strong time management are essential.

Productivity Expectations
  • Maintain 90% productivity standards
  • Manage a caseload of approximately 30 therapy hours per week (full-time equivalent)
  • Ensure timely completion of documentation and service delivery
